freecolor: Bus error. software or hardware problem?

2010-07-23 Thread Antonio Kless
Strange freecolor behavior on fresh 8.0-RELEASE system.

# uname -a
FreeBSD alternate-1.net 8.0-RELEASE FreeBSD 8.0-RELEASE #0: Sat Nov 21
15:02:08 UTC 2009 r...@mason.cse.buffalo.edu:/usr/obj/usr/src/sys/GENERIC
amd64

# freecolor -V
freecolor version 0.8.8

# freecolor
Bus error


I have reinstall 7.3-RELEASE on this server, and get another look of error:

# freecolor
Bus error: 10


Is it software or hardware problem?

Re: freecolor: Bus error. software or hardware problem?

2010-07-23 Thread Randy Belk
Have you updated your ports? This was an issue on the amd64 distribution,
but it was fixed.
